What Nobody Is Explaining About Autonomous Token Economies
Here is the fundamental concept that almost nobody breaks down clearly: an autonomous agent economy only becomes sustainable when agents can earn revenue independently through services they provide to users without constant subsidy from token emissions or developer grants. Without this capability, you have a pyramid structure — tokens flow in from new investors to pay earlier participants until new money stops arriving and then the whole thing collapses.
The reality I’ve observed across twelve major AI agent projects during my research period is that fewer than five of them currently meet this sustainability threshold. Most are running on venture capital fuel, burning through millions in funding while marketing ambitious roadmaps that remain purely theoretical at current technological maturity levels.

Technical Deep Dive: How to Spot a Fake AI Agent Token Project in 60 Seconds
Here is my exact checklist that I use when evaluating whether any “AI agent” project genuinely operates autonomous systems or is just wrapping existing API calls in a token wrapper:
- 1. Check on-chain activity patterns. If the agent transaction logs show requests going to centralized endpoints (e.g., anthropic.com, openai.com) instead of decentralized compute infrastructure (like Bittensor subnets or LAB Protocol’s own inference network), then the “autonomous” claim is largely false.
- 2. Look for independent revenue generation. Can agents earn tokens by performing services? If every agent requires token emission subsidies to stay operational, it fails my sustainability test immediately.
- 3. Search for verifiable autonomous task completion records. Does the project publish a public dashboard showing agents completing tasks without human intervention 24/7? If not — or if those dashboards only show curated success stories from promotional events — proceed with extreme caution.
- 4. Examine the token distribution schedule. Projects where more than 60% of circulating supply remains locked (team allocation, early investor tranches, ecosystem fund reserves) inherently face enormous future selling pressure as unlocks occur.
If four out of five checks produce negative or inconclusive results — which is the case for most AI agent projects in 2026 — do not deploy capital. The risks massively outweigh whatever theoretical upside might exist from waiting and watching further development unfold.

The Regulatory Risks Nobody Discusses
While most media coverage focuses exclusively on the exciting capabilities of AI agent economics platforms, regulatory authorities in multiple jurisdictions have begun examining whether certain autonomous agent token structures may constitute unregistered securities offerings. Here is what we know so far:
- The U.S. SEC has not publicly classified any AI agent token as a security, but enforcement attorneys at the agency have expressed increasing interest in how “autonomous economic agents” interact with traditional financial markets — particularly when autonomous systems execute trades or manage assets autonomously.
- European regulators operating under MiCA are developing specific frameworks for autonomous digital agents that operate across blockchain networks, though these guidelines remain in preliminary form with final implementation dates still uncertain.
- Asian jurisdictions (Singapore and Japan) appear more welcoming of AI agent token economies compared to their Western counterparts, potentially positioning themselves as preferred deployment ecosystems for teams that find Western regulatory constraints too restrictive over time.
The key concern I raise here is not about immediate bans or enforcement actions — which seem unlikely in most jurisdictions during current political climates — but rather the longer-term implications for token holders: if regulators determine that many AI agent tokens qualify as unregistered securities, the consequences would include forced delistings from major exchange platforms and potential criminal liability for project founders.
This scenario seems remote today based on official statements I have reviewed. But in my seven years covering the cryptocurrency industry, I have learned that regulatory shifts can arrive with very little warning once specific thresholds of systemic risk attract attention from lawmakers. Any allocation you make to AI agent tokens should factor this possibility into your risk assessment framework immediately — not as a prediction but as a prudent risk management exercise.
